Understanding Post-Consultation Communication
After your initial consultation with an auto body shop, understanding how and when to expect communication from them is crucial. This period is vital as it sets the tone for the entire repair process. The post-consultation phase involves several key steps that customers should be aware of. Typically, a car body shop will reach out within 24 hours to provide an estimated cost for the repairs, detailed in a clear and concise quote.
This quote may include options for various services, such as paintless dent repair or vehicle restoration, depending on the extent of the damage. Customers can then review the proposal and ask any questions they might have. Effective communication ensures that both parties are on the same page regarding expectations and allows for informed decisions about the car’s aesthetic and structural repairs.
Key Elements of an Effective Auto Body Shop Call
When it comes to effective communication with an auto body shop after a consultation, several key elements make the difference between a satisfactory and a disappointing experience. Firstly, clear and detailed information exchange is vital. The shop should provide a comprehensive breakdown of the estimated costs involved in the repair process, including labor and parts for both the auto glass repair and more intricate automotive body work. This transparency allows customers to understand the financial commitment required and makes informed decisions.
Additionally, ensuring timely follow-ups and keeping customers updated throughout is crucial. Body shop services can often have varying timelines due to the complexity of repairs. A professional shop should regularly communicate any delays or changes in the estimated completion date, offering realistic expectations and adhering to customer convenience. This level of communication fosters trust and ensures a positive post-consultation experience.
Preparing for and Responding to Inquiries After Consultation
After your initial consultation with an auto body shop regarding your vehicle’s damages, it’s essential to be prepared for and respond to their subsequent inquiries efficiently. This is a crucial step in ensuring smooth communication and accurate repair estimates. Many auto body shops will ask for detailed information about the incident, including dates, times, and any witness statements. Be ready to provide this information clearly and concisely, as it aids in their assessment and helps establish the sequence of events leading up to the damage.
When responding to questions, remember to include all relevant details related to your vehicle’s condition before and after the incident. Discuss any pre-existing damage or recent modifications that could impact the repair process. Additionally, be transparent about your expectations regarding repairs, including whether you prefer original equipment manufacturer (OEM) parts for vehicle paint repair or if you’re open to high-quality aftermarket alternatives. This openness allows the body shop to tailor their services to your needs and preferences while providing an accurate estimate for automotive body work.
